"You can transfer in [to a sorority]???" To quell some confusion: once you join a sorority, you can't join another one. Sororities have national organizations but also chapters, basically branch groups, so if you need to transfer schools, you can transfer chapters without having to re-do all the pledge stuff over again. non-american here, what if the uni that i transfer to doesn't have the sorority i joined? or is it like every single one of them is in every uni/college?
@@astridkjellberg if the new school doesn’t have your sorority then you can’t join another. the chapters of sororities on campus varies from school to school but some are more common than others
